File tree Expand file tree Collapse file tree 3 files changed +7
-2
lines changed
main/java/org/springframework/http/converter/json
test/java/org/springframework/http/converter/json Expand file tree Collapse file tree 3 files changed +7
-2
lines changed Original file line number Diff line number Diff line change @@ -338,11 +338,13 @@ public Jackson2ObjectMapperBuilder autoDetectFields(boolean autoDetectFields) {
338338
339339 /**
340340 * Shortcut for {@link MapperFeature#AUTO_DETECT_SETTERS}/
341- * {@link MapperFeature#AUTO_DETECT_GETTERS} option.
341+ * {@link MapperFeature#AUTO_DETECT_GETTERS}/{@link MapperFeature#AUTO_DETECT_IS_GETTERS}
342+ * options.
342343 */
343344 public Jackson2ObjectMapperBuilder autoDetectGettersSetters (boolean autoDetectGettersSetters ) {
344345 this .features .put (MapperFeature .AUTO_DETECT_GETTERS , autoDetectGettersSetters );
345346 this .features .put (MapperFeature .AUTO_DETECT_SETTERS , autoDetectGettersSetters );
347+ this .features .put (MapperFeature .AUTO_DETECT_IS_GETTERS , autoDetectGettersSetters );
346348 return this ;
347349 }
348350
Original file line number Diff line number Diff line change @@ -269,7 +269,8 @@ public void setAutoDetectFields(boolean autoDetectFields) {
269269
270270 /**
271271 * Shortcut for {@link MapperFeature#AUTO_DETECT_SETTERS}/
272- * {@link MapperFeature#AUTO_DETECT_GETTERS} option.
272+ * {@link MapperFeature#AUTO_DETECT_GETTERS}/{@link MapperFeature#AUTO_DETECT_IS_GETTERS}
273+ * options.
273274 */
274275 public void setAutoDetectGettersSetters (boolean autoDetectGettersSetters ) {
275276 this .builder .autoDetectGettersSetters (autoDetectGettersSetters );
Original file line number Diff line number Diff line change @@ -103,6 +103,7 @@ public void defaultProperties() {
103103 assertFalse (objectMapper .isEnabled (DeserializationFeature .FAIL_ON_UNKNOWN_PROPERTIES ));
104104 assertTrue (objectMapper .isEnabled (MapperFeature .AUTO_DETECT_FIELDS ));
105105 assertTrue (objectMapper .isEnabled (MapperFeature .AUTO_DETECT_GETTERS ));
106+ assertTrue (objectMapper .isEnabled (MapperFeature .AUTO_DETECT_IS_GETTERS ));
106107 assertTrue (objectMapper .isEnabled (MapperFeature .AUTO_DETECT_SETTERS ));
107108 assertFalse (objectMapper .isEnabled (SerializationFeature .INDENT_OUTPUT ));
108109 assertTrue (objectMapper .isEnabled (SerializationFeature .FAIL_ON_EMPTY_BEANS ));
@@ -118,6 +119,7 @@ public void propertiesShortcut() {
118119 assertTrue (objectMapper .isEnabled (DeserializationFeature .FAIL_ON_UNKNOWN_PROPERTIES ));
119120 assertFalse (objectMapper .isEnabled (MapperFeature .AUTO_DETECT_FIELDS ));
120121 assertFalse (objectMapper .isEnabled (MapperFeature .AUTO_DETECT_GETTERS ));
122+ assertFalse (objectMapper .isEnabled (MapperFeature .AUTO_DETECT_IS_GETTERS ));
121123 assertFalse (objectMapper .isEnabled (MapperFeature .AUTO_DETECT_SETTERS ));
122124 assertTrue (objectMapper .isEnabled (SerializationFeature .INDENT_OUTPUT ));
123125 assertFalse (objectMapper .isEnabled (SerializationFeature .FAIL_ON_EMPTY_BEANS ));
You can’t perform that action at this time.
0 commit comments